The Importance Of Controlling Water Heater Temperature To Prevent Legionnaires Disease
Legionnaires disease is a severe form of pneumonia caused by bacteria known as Legionella This potentially fatal disease can be contracted by inhaling the bacteria, which is commonly found in water sources such as lakes, rivers, and cooling towers One common source of Legionella bacteria is water heaters, making it crucial to control the temperature of your water heater to prevent the spread of Legionnaires disease.
The ideal temperature range for preventing the growth of Legionella bacteria in water heaters is between 120-140 degrees Fahrenheit At temperatures below 120 degrees Fahrenheit, the bacteria can survive and multiply, increasing the risk of Legionnaires disease Conversely, temperatures above 140 degrees Fahrenheit can scald the skin and increase energy consumption without providing any additional benefits in preventing Legionella growth.
Maintaining the proper water heater temperature is especially important in buildings such as hospitals, hotels, and nursing homes, where individuals with weakened immune systems are more vulnerable to Legionnaires disease Regular monitoring and adjusting of water heater temperatures can help reduce the risk of Legionella contamination and protect the health of occupants.
In addition to controlling water heater temperature, there are other measures that can be taken to prevent Legionnaires disease in water systems Regular cleaning and disinfection of water tanks, pipes, and fixtures can help eliminate any build-up of bacteria Flushing out stagnant water and properly maintaining water heaters can also prevent the growth of Legionella bacteria.
